Upgrading a production machine tool for precision machining

This report summarizes the work done to apply state-of-the-art precision-machining technology to an existing machine tool. A two-axis, T-base lathe was retrofitted with air-bearing slides and spindle, laser interferometer feedback, electric drives, a vibration-isolation base, and a computer numerical control system. The resulting contouring capability for a spherical part improved from 4 ..mu..m (160 ..mu..in.) to 1.27 ..mu..m (50 ..mu..in.) while the surface finish capability improved from approx. 0.23 ..mu..m (9 ..mu..in.) to 0.1 ..mu..m (4 ..mu..in.) peak-to-valley.
